What Is Clay?#

Clay is a go-to-market (GTM) platform designed to automate and optimize sales workflows. It helps teams streamline their outreach efforts by combining data enrichment, automation, and personalization into one powerful tool.

Recently, Clay has gained popularity among GTM teams due to its ability to enhance lead enrichment. By pulling data from over 50 sources, it provides sales teams with accurate and up-to-date contact information, making outreach efforts more precise and effective. However, while Clay offers significant value, it may not fully align with every company’s specific needs.

Key Features of Clay:

  • Automated GTM workflows – Simplifies complex sales processes, reducing manual effort.
  • Data enrichment from 50+ sources – Pulls verified contact details to improve targeting accuracy.
  • Personalized outreach at scale – Uses AI-driven insights to craft customized messages for prospects.
  • CRM and tool integration – Works seamlessly with existing sales and marketing platforms.
  • Lead list automation – Finds and filters high-quality leads, ensuring sales teams focus on the right prospects.
  • Revenue-focused approach – Helps businesses connect with decision-makers and drive growth.

Why Consider Alternatives to Clay?#

A good outreach tool should save you time, simplify your workflow, and deliver results without hassle. While Clay offers powerful features, it might not be the best fit for every team. Here are some reasons why you might want to explore other options.

Steep Learning Curve#

Clay’s setup can be overwhelming, especially if you don’t have a dedicated operations team. Many users find the platform complex and time-consuming to configure, leading to frustration when all they need is a tool that works smoothly from the start.

Time-Consuming for the Wrong Use Cases#

If you don’t have a well-defined use case, Clay can quickly turn into a major time drain. Some users describe it as a “black hole” that requires constant adjustments and monitoring to be effective.

Unintuitive Interface#

Clay’s user interface has been criticized for being confusing, with key settings buried deep within the platform. The reliance on dark mode and a cluttered design can make navigation difficult, reducing overall usability.

High Cost Compared to Competitors#

Clay’s pricing structure often leaves users questioning its value. The cost of credits can add up quickly, making it an expensive choice—especially when other platforms offer similar features at a lower price point.

Scalability Limitations#

Some users report hitting connection limits and struggling with integrations, making it difficult to scale operations effectively. If your business is growing and requires seamless expansion, Clay’s restrictions could become a roadblock.

ZoomInfo#

ZoomInfo is a powerful sales intelligence platform that helps businesses access contact data, buying signals, and detailed business insights. It offers a suite of tools designed to help sales teams identify high-potential leads and reach decision-makers at the right time.

Beyond lead sourcing, ZoomInfo enables users to analyze customer interactions across emails, meetings, and calls, providing actionable insights to optimize sales processes. However, its credit-based pricing model can lead to unexpectedly high costs, and some advanced features are only available in premium plans.

Best Features#
  • Sales engagement tools for multi-channel outreach
  • Data orchestration for managing and enriching lead information
  • Intent data to track prospects actively looking for solutions
  • Website visitor tracking to identify anonymous traffic
Pricing#
  • ZoomInfo offers different pricing tiers for sales, marketing, and recruitment teams
  • Exact pricing isn’t listed publicly—you’ll need to contact their sales team for a quote
Pros & Cons#

Pros:

  • Extensive database with verified contact information
  • AI-driven insights for better lead targeting
  • Robust sales automation features

Cons:

  • Pricing is not transparent and can be expensive
  • Some key features are locked behind higher-tier plans
  • Credit-based system may limit data access depending on the subscription level
Adapt.io#

Adapt.io is a data-driven sales intelligence platform that helps businesses build targeted email lists and access verified contact information. With its advanced filtering options, users can refine their prospect lists and improve outreach efficiency.

In addition to lead generation, Adapt.io offers email tracking and analytics to measure the success of sales campaigns. However, unlike some competitors, it does not provide intent data, which can be a drawback for businesses looking to identify highly engaged prospects.

Best Features#
  • Data enrichment for accurate and up-to-date contact information
  • Email tracking and analytics to monitor engagement
  • Contacts list builder with advanced filtering options
  • Chrome extension for quick access to data while browsing
Pricing#
  • Adapt.io does not list its pricing publicly—you’ll need to request a quote from their team
Pros & Cons#

Pros:

  • Reliable data for sales prospecting
  • Email tracking helps optimize outreach strategies
  • Chrome extension allows easy access to lead data

Cons:

  • No intent data to track buyer signals
  • Pricing details are not available upfront
Cognism#

Cognism is an AI-powered sales intelligence platform designed to help enterprise teams identify high-value prospects, meet sales targets, and build a strong pipeline. With GDPR and CCPA-compliant B2B data, it ensures businesses can engage with potential clients worldwide while staying within regulatory guidelines.

One of Cognism’s standout features is Cognism Enrich, which helps keep contact lists up to date by refreshing outdated records and filling in missing details. It’s a strong choice for those looking for advanced data enrichment and seamless integrations with CRM and sales engagement tools.

Best Features#
  • Phone-verified contact data, ensuring high connection rates
  • Diamond Data®—an exclusive database of verified phone and email contacts
  • Automated CRM and CSV enrichment to keep data fresh
  • Signal and intent data to identify engaged prospects
  • Global reach across EMEA, NAM, and APAC markets
  • Cognism AI Search, allowing users to find leads using ChatGPT-style prompts
Pricing#
  • Pricing is customized based on business needs and must be requested directly from Cognism
Pros & Cons#

Pros:

  • High-quality, GDPR- and CCPA-compliant data
  • AI-powered insights improve sales prospecting
  • Phone-verified numbers increase successful connections
  • Strong international coverage

Cons:

  • Pricing is not transparent and varies by business
  • Fair usage policy applies to some data features
  • May be too advanced for small businesses with simpler needs
Hunter.io#

Hunter.io is a comprehensive email outreach platform designed to help businesses find and verify qualified B2B contacts. It ensures that your outreach efforts are effective by verifying email addresses, reducing bounce rates, and improving overall deliverability.

The platform’s Hunter Discover feature allows users to search a vast B2B lead database, making it easier to find prospects that match their ideal customer profile. Additionally, Hunter integrates with various CRMs and productivity tools, streamlining workflows for sales and marketing teams.

Best Features#
  • B2B Lead Prospecting through the Hunter Discover database
  • Email Verification for bulk emails and individual contacts
  • API access for seamless email verification in real time
  • Integrations with Google Sheets, Zapier, HubSpot, Salesforce, and more
Pricing#
  • Free plan with limited searches
  • Starter plan: $34 per month
  • Growth plan: $104 per month
  • Business plan: $349 per month
Pros & Cons#

Pros:

  • Reliable email verification reduces bounce rates
  • Large B2B lead database for targeted prospecting
  • Integrates with major CRM and automation tools
  • Free plan available for basic use

Cons:

  • No direct email extraction from LinkedIn, Twitter, or other social platforms
  • Pricing can be high for startups or small businesses
Seamless.AI#

Seamless.AI is an AI-powered sales intelligence platform designed to help sales teams find and connect with their ideal customers. Its real-time search engine provides up-to-date contact data, making prospecting more efficient.

Unlike Clay, Seamless.AI includes buyer intent data, which helps sales teams focus on leads that are more likely to convert. However, it operates on a credit-based pricing model, which may lead to additional costs depending on usage.

Best Features#
  • Real-time data verification to ensure accurate contact details
  • Job change alerts to keep track of prospect movements
  • Buyer intent data to identify high-potential leads
  • Automated list-building for streamlined prospecting
  • AI-powered writer for crafting outreach messages
Pricing#
  • Free plan available
  • Basic, Pro, and Enterprise plans (pricing available upon request)
Pros & Cons#

Pros:

  • AI-powered search engine for finding accurate contact data
  • Buyer intent data helps prioritize leads
  • Job change alerts keep outreach relevant
  • Automated list-building saves time

Cons:

  • Credit-based pricing can lead to unexpected costs
  • No transparent pricing—users must request details
FAQs#

1. Is there a free alternative to Clay?

Yes, some alternatives like Hunter.io and Seamless.AI offer free plans with limited features. However, most advanced sales intelligence tools require a paid subscription for full functionality.

2. How does buyer intent data help in sales outreach?

Buyer intent data identifies prospects who are actively searching for solutions like yours. This helps sales teams prioritize high-intent leads and personalize their outreach for better conversion rates.

3. Do Clay alternatives work with LinkedIn for lead generation?

Some alternatives, like ZoomInfo and Cognism, offer LinkedIn integrations or workarounds for sourcing leads. However, Hunter.io does not support direct email extraction from social platforms.

4. Are there Clay alternatives with pay-as-you-go pricing?

Most platforms use subscription or credit-based pricing models. Some, like Hunter.io, offer flexible plans, but true pay-as-you-go options are rare in sales intelligence software.

5. What is the best Clay alternative for small businesses?

For small businesses on a budget, Adapt.io and Hunter.io offer cost-effective solutions with essential features like data enrichment, email tracking, and lead generation.
